The human body is composed of roughly 7 octillion atoms, which is 7 followed by 27 zeros (7 x 10^27). This vast number includes a variety of elements, with the most abundant being oxygen, carbon, hydrogen, and nitrogen. The exact count can vary based on an individual's size and composition, but it highlights the complexity and intricate molecular structure of human Biology.
